etching on silver is a time-honored technique that has been used for centuries to create stunning works of art. The process involves applying a resist material, such as wax or a special etching ink, to the surface of the silver. The design is then drawn or painted onto the resist material, exposing the areas of the silver that will be etched. The piece is then submerged in an etchant solution, such as nitric acid, which eats away at the exposed areas of the silver, leaving behind the intricate design.

etching on silver also allows for a great deal of creativity and experimentation. The resist material can be applied in a variety of ways, such as using a brush, sponge, or even a stamp, allowing for different textures and effects to be achieved. Additionally, the etchant solution can be diluted or applied for different lengths of time to create different effects, such as a matte or shiny finish. This versatility allows for endless possibilities when it comes to creating etched designs on silver.

There are a few key tips to keep in mind when etching on silver to ensure the best results. First, it is important to use the proper safety precautions when working with etchant solutions, such as wearing protective gloves and working in a well-ventilated area. It is also important to carefully follow the manufacturer’s instructions for the etchant solution, as using the solution incorrectly can result in damage to the silver or even injury.
Another important tip is to practice your design on a scrap piece of silver before etching the final piece. This will allow you to test out different techniques and effects before committing to the design, ensuring that you achieve the desired result.
